Tetradrachm with Alexander III "The Great" of Macedon as Herakles
Medium:Struck silver
Geography: Mint of Arados (modern Arwād), Syria; found in Damanhur, Egypt
Date: c. 328-320 BC
Period: Reign of Alexander III "The Great" of Macedon

Description
From a deposit of over 8000 silver coins known as the "Demanhur Hoard" found in a pot at Damanhūr, Egypt. The burial date of the hoard is estimated to be around 318 BC.
